I grew up knowing that I was named after a famed seamstress in the Bible, so I always felt the urge to follow in her footsteps. Unfortunately, I just do not enjoy using a sewing machine (so I leave most of the sewing to my daughter, who can work magic with it). I do enjoy hand stitching aprons and lap quilts, but over the years I have also learned to cross stitch, embroider, candlewick, chicken-scratch, and even to "paint with beads" and bead on wire. I have spent most of my life embellishing my world in that way. I believe an artist breathes life in to mundane items and creates a heartbeat that others can feel when they gaze upon the finished project. My creations are small, but I always strive to bring out that vibrant hum of life in each piece. I do crafting for the sheer joy and peace it brings me, and I hope that you will feel that joy and peace when you take home something from my shop.
